Factors to Consider
Filtration efficiency, CADR, and particle sizes
⚡ Quick Answer
CADR and filtration efficiency are the practical measures of real cleaning performance. True HEPA captures 99.97% of 0.3 μm particles, and H13/H14 media used in quality purifiers often meet or exceed this for pet allergens. For pet allergies, target particles in the 0.3–5 μm range, where most dander-laden aerosols reside. Room size coverage matters: select a unit with CADR matched to your space (roughly 150–200 CFM for a 300–400 sq ft room; higher CADR for open layouts); this helps achieve meaningful air changes per hour. Replacement costs: typical HEPA cartridges run $30–60, with prefilters $10–20, and total annual costs scale with usage.

Sizing for pet allergies and HVAC integration
Whole-house filtration relies on matching the device to your home's air volume and HVAC layout. For pet allergies, aim for 4–6 air changes per hour in the spaces you use most, which often means a higher CADR and possibly multiple returns or zone filtering. Look for manufacturers that list room-size coverage in square feet or ACH targets and verify compatibility with your furnace blower. Replacement costs for whole-house filters are typically higher, with larger cartridges costing roughly $50–100 each and annual maintenance depending on system use.
Filter lifecycle, media options, and ongoing costs
Beyond the main filter, consider prefilters and activated carbon for odors and VOCs common in homes with pets. Filtration frequency depends on pet presence and shedding—pets can shorten filter life to around 6–12 months in many setups. Room size coverage matters because an undersized filter will underperform in open plans or high-traffic areas; use the stated sq ft or ACH to guide replacement timing. Replacement costs vary by media: carbon filters add roughly $20–50 per unit, while HEPA cartridges commonly run $30–60, with total yearly costs rising with more frequent changes.
Noise, energy use, and practical spring usage
Noise level matters when you’ll run purifiers for long periods, particularly in bedrooms or study spaces; look for dB ratings and choose models with quiet modes at 20–40 dB. Energy efficiency matters for year-round operation, so compare wattage and check for ENERGY STAR certifications to estimate annual operating costs. The room-size policy still applies: a device sized for your space will perform better and avoid unnecessary energy use than a too-large unit running at low speed. Filter replacement costs add to the ongoing cost of ownership, typically $30–60 per HEPA cartridge and $10–20 per prefilter, depending on usage and accessibility.
Frequently Asked Questions
What does CADR mean and how do I translate it to room coverage?
CADR is a standardized metric published by AHAM that estimates how quickly a purifier can clean a given room size. A higher CADR means faster removal of smoke, dust, and pollen, which correlates with better control of airborne pet allergens. For practical sizing, aim for a CADR that matches your room size (roughly 150–200 CFM for a 300–400 sq ft space); larger open layouts typically require higher CADR or additional units to achieve 4–6 air changes per hour.
Are HEPA purifiers truly effective against pet dander?
Yes. True HEPA filters capture 99.97% of particles at 0.3 μm, which encompasses most pet dander carriers; pet allergens are often attached to particles within the 1–10 μm range, so HEPA filtration reduces airborne dander. Effectiveness depends on airflow, maintenance, and how well the unit is sized for the space.
How often should I replace filters in a pet-friendly home?
In homes with dogs or cats, many purifiers require filter changes every 6–12 months, depending on shedding and usage. Replacement costs typically run $30–60 for HEPA cartridges and $20–50 for carbon or combined media; if you have odor concerns, factor carbon filter replacements into the budget. Regular replacement helps maintain the expected CADR and filtration efficiency over time.
Can an air purifier remove odors from pets?
Purifiers with activated carbon or other odor-absorbing media can reduce pet odors and certain VOCs, but they don’t eliminate odors completely without adequate air turnover and cleaning of the environment. For best results, pair filtration with good ventilation and regular cleaning of pet areas.
Are ozone-generating purifiers safe for homes with pets?
Ozone generators can irritate lungs and mucous membranes in both people and animals; choose non-ozone-producing purifiers and look for CARB certification to ensure safety. For pet owners, HEPA filtration without ozone is the recommended path for consistent allergen control.
Do I need professional installation for a whole-house purifier?
Most whole-house units require installation into the HVAC ductwork, which is best done by a professional to ensure proper sizing and minimal pressure drop. After installation, ensure the system is sized for your home’s total CFM and that you replace filters as recommended; ongoing costs follow the same scale as individual units.
How should I place purifiers in an open floor plan?
Place purifiers in central locations with good air movement and away from walls to maximize cross-flow; in open layouts, multiple units or zone filtration can improve overall air quality. Always verify each unit’s stated room coverage to avoid oversizing or undersizing that could compromise performance.
